Alan Dreezer

Alan Dreezer is an Electro Pop/Singer-Songwriter from Chelmsford Essex UK currently living in Spain. He has until now always collaborated with other musicians or as part of a band away from his passion for Electronic Music. These have included touring with Tara 2 a pop duo supporting 80’s favorites “Brother Beyond”, or playing sold-out shows at High Barn Great Bardfield which was widely regarded as one of the best small venues in the UK with Rock-Pop band ADProject. Alan released his first solo album “LONDON E12” in 2018. He has since released 5 singles from his forthcoming sophomore album “H E A L E D” due for release in 2021 and was recently nominated in the Best Solo Artist category at the 2020 Essex Panic Awards.
